Virial Coefficients of Hexane

Component

Formula Molar Mass CAS Registry Number Name
C6H14 86.177 110-54-3 Hexane

Data Table

T [K] Second Virial Coefficient [cm3/mol] State Reference
308.15 -1729.0000 Vapor 3
323.20 -1605.0000 Vapor 2
328.20 -1607.0000 Vapor 2
338.20 -1408.0000 Vapor 2
348.15 -1224.0000 Vapor 6
348.15 -1220.0000 Vapor 1
348.20 -1294.0000 Vapor 2
348.20 -1289.0000 Vapor 2
358.20 -1220.0000 Vapor 2
373.20 -1110.0000 Vapor 2
523.00 -451.8000 Vapor 4
523.15 -448.6000 Vapor 5
573.00 -354.2000 Vapor 4
573.15 -354.4000 Vapor 5
623.00 -286.3000 Vapor 4
623.15 -293.1000 Vapor 5
663.15 -213.6000 Vapor 5

List of References

Number Source
1 Kasprzycka-Guttman T.; Chojnacka I.: (Vapour + liquid) equilibria of (pyridine or alpha-picoline + a C6 to C10 n-alkane) at 348.15 K. J.Chem.Thermodyn. 21 (1989) 721-725
2 Xueqin A.; McElroy P.J.; Malhotra R.; Weiguo S.; Williamson A.G.: Accurate Second Virial Coefficients of n-Alkanes. J.Chem.Thermodyn. 22 (1990) 487-499
3 Fenclova D.; Dohnal V.: (Vapour + liquid) equilibria of {1-bromo-1-chloro-2,2,2-trifluoroethane (halothane) + an oxygenated solvent or hexane}. J.Chem.Thermodyn. 25 (1993) 689-697
4 Abdulagatov I.M.; Bazaev A.R.; Ramazanova A.E.: PVTx-Properties and Virial Coefficients of the Water - n-Hexane System. Int.J.Phys.Chem.Ber.Bunsen-Ges. 98 (1994) 1596-1600
5 Abdulagatov I.M.; Bazaev A.R.; Gasanov R.K.; Ramazanova A.E.: Measurements of the (P, rho, T) Properties and Virial Coefficients of Pure Water, Methane, n-Hexane, n-Octane, Benzene and of their Aqueous Mixtures in the Supercritical Region. J.Chem.Thermodyn. 28 (1996) 1037-1057
6 Semeniuk B.; Kasprzycka-Guttman T.: (Vapour + liquid) equilibria of (beta- or gamma-picoline + a C6 to C9 n-alkane) at 348.15 K. J.Chem.Thermodyn. 20 (1988) 1427-1431
